    Every year I decorate the exterior of my home with a concept in mind. This year I'm having trouble coming up with some appropriate large props that work with my home.

    The concept is Freak Show Gone Wrong (or Carnevil or Evil Circus, anything like that will work). I have a few ideas but nothing seems to be working out.

    I live in a 3 story townhouse that is made of limestone so I can't drill into the house to attach anything (but i usually get around this by using fishing wire to hold what needs to be held up). The items need to be large enough and vertical. And finally I don't have a garage so my DIY skills are somewhat limited (but Im totally willing to get my hands dirty!)

    Can anyone think of something pratical to do that gets the look? I'd love to hear your thoughts.
